Dear Maria, your struggles resonate deeply with many who are navigating the demanding seasons of life. First, I want to remind you that you are not alone; God sees you and your efforts. In Matthew 11:28, Jesus calls us, saying, 'Come unto me, all ye that labour and are heavy laden, and I will give you rest.' This promise is especially for you, as you find yourself weary from balancing so much. Consider Psalm 150:6, which reminds us that everything that hath breath should praise the Lord. Even in the chaos, there are opportunities for worship—perhaps a moment of gratitude while driving or a prayer before bedtime with your children. The revival you seek can come in small, intentional moments that enrich your spirit. I encourage you to carve out even five minutes a day to be still before the Lord. Let’s pray for His strength to guide you, for renewed energy, and that you find joy in His presence amidst your busy life.
